Process for obtaining a decorative mirror
11899228 · 2024-02-13 · ·

A process for obtaining a decorative mirror includes reflective regions forming a pattern and non-reflective regions, the process including providing a sheet of soda-lime-silica glass coated with a reflective coating on the entirety of one of the faces thereof, then applying a composition including a phosphate salt to the reflective coating, solely in application regions, the application regions being intended to become the non-reflective regions, then tempering the glass sheet, in which the glass sheet is subjected to a temperature of at least 550? C., causing the reflective coating to dissolve in the application regions so as to form the non-reflective regions in which the glass sheet is not coated.

Composite tungsten oxide film and method for producing same, and film-deposited base material and article each provided with said film

A composite tungsten oxide film having high film smoothness, with a function to shield infrared light by reflecting infrared light by a thermal insulation, while maintaining transparency in a visible light region, and a method for manufacturing the composite tungsten oxide film, and a film-deposited base material or an article using these functions. A composite tungsten oxide film including a composition with a general formula M.sub.xW.sub.yO.sub.z as main components, wherein 0.001?x/y?1, 2.2?z/y?3.0, organic components are not contained substantially, a transmittance in a wavelength of 550 nm is 50% or more, a transmittance in a wavelength of 1400 nm is 30% or less, and also, a reflectance in a wavelength of 1400 nm is 35% or more.

Method for producing a pane having an electrically conductive coating with electrically insulated defects

A method for producing a pane having an electrically conductive coating is described. The method includes applying an electrically conductive coating onto a substrate, identifying defects of the coating, focusing the radiation of a laser having an annular beam profile on the coating, wherein the annular beam profile surrounds the defect, and producing an annular de-coated region by simultaneously removing the coating in the region of the beam profile.
